We started Hooklift because
we kept seeing the same thing.

SaaS companies doing $50M ARR — running the same Meta ad from Q3 2024. Same hook. Same opener. Sometimes literally the same actor. The brands had the budget. They had the team. They had the agency on retainer.

They didn't have the throughput.

Creative is the lever Meta's algorithm rewards now — not targeting, not bid strategy. And the founders we kept talking to all knew it. The problem wasn't that they didn't care. The problem was that shipping a fresh hook every two weeks — the cadence the platform actually wants — requires a production engine. Most internal teams ship one to two. Most agencies turn it into a deck.

Hooklift is what we wanted as operators — the embedded creative arm that ships, not the agency that pitches.
